ZIP code 16001 is a densely settled ZIP (a standard USPS delivery area) in Butler, Butler County, Pennsylvania, with 40,371 residents across 190.2 square miles, a density of 212 people per square mile, in the New York time zone.
ZIP 16001 reports a modest median household income of $63,635 (18% below the average Pennsylvania ZIP), while per-capita income is $40,413. The poverty rate is 12.1%, with unemployment at 5.6%; those measures add context to the income figure. Median home value is $199,100 (12% below the average Pennsylvania ZIP) and median rent is $851; 68.4% of occupied homes are owner-occupied.
Educational attainment sits below the national norm: 27.6%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, the median age is 44.9, and the average commute is 25 minutes. Home values in ZIP 16001 have increased 5.3% over the past year (2024). Since 2000, this ZIP has seen +106% cumulative appreciation.
| Year | Annual Change | HPI Index |
|---|---|---|
| 2020 | +5.2% | 151 |
| 2021 | +8.2% | 164 |
| 2022 | +10.8% | 182 |
| 2023 | +7.6% | 195 |
| 2024 | +5.3% | 206 |
Source: Federal Housing Finance Agency (FHFA) House Price Index, All-Transactions, Five-Digit ZIP Codes (Developmental Index). Index base = 100 in year 2000. Data through 2024. ZIP codes with few transactions may show missing values.
